WebOct 29, 2024 · The station rotation model does exactly what the name suggests. It is a series of stations, or learning activities that students rotate through. Typically, there is a teacher-led station, an online station, and an offline station. To be considered a blended learning model, at least one station must be an online learning station. WebNov 29, 2024 · Blended learning is the combination of active, engaged learning online with active, engaged learning offline to provide students with more control over the time, place, pace, and path of their learning. WebSep 6, 2024 · Four Rotation Models. The phrase “blended learning” is an umbrella that encompasses a range of different models that combine online and offline learning in various ways. Each model gives students different degrees of control over the time, place, pace, and path of their learning. Traditionally, classroom instruction has largely been teacher-directed, … WebSep 7, 2024 · Engagement is the students’ active involvement in learning that they perceive as relevant, valuable, and interesting. Within the principle of engagement there are three guidelines: 1) providing options for self-regulation, 2) providing options for sustaining effort and persistence, and 3) providing options for recruiting interest. WebNov 17, 2024 · In case you also do that, you need to understand that both learning styles are different. The key difference between the two learning styles is that blended learning only works by combining two things: eLearning and traditional learning. WebFeb 28, 2024 · Easier Differentiation of Instruction. Blended learning allows for multiple ways to reach educational goals. Blended learning not only provides for a variety of instructional methods, but it also frees up teacher time through the use of automated instruction and other technology tools.
